CHAPTER 71.

Meeting.

AN ACT to authorize the Commissioners of Som-
erset county, to cause to be built a new jail in said
county.

Passed Mar.
6, 1856.

SECTION 1. Be it enacted by the General Assem-
bly of Maryland, That the Commissioners of Som-
erset county, be, and they are hereby authorized and
empowered, to cause to be erected or built, a new
jail in said county, if they shall believe that the wants
or necessities of the people require it, and levy the
cost thereof upon the assessable property of the
county.

Commissions
authorised.

SEC. 2. And be it enacted. That the said Commis-
sioners, or a majority of them, are authorized and
empowered to sell the present jail and Jot, and apply
the proceeds thereof, so far as they may be sufficient,
towards the purchase of a new lot and erection of a
new jail, if they shall deem it advisable so to do.

Empowered
to sell.

SEC 3. And be it enacted, That the plan of said
building or jail, as well as the materials with which
the same may be constructed, is hereby left to the
sound discretion of the said commissioners, or a ma-
jority of them, they having due regard to the objects
and purposes for which the said building is required
